Cypress Creek Renewables develops, finances, owns, and operates utility-scale solar and energy storage assets across 28 U.S. states. With more than 850 projects commercialized and 19GW of total capacity, the company runs a vertically integrated model - construction, operations, maintenance, and 24/7/365 monitoring - where the convergence of IT and OT is not theoretical. It's the grid edge, and it's live.
Founded in 2014 with a team of 400+ professionals, Cypress Creek's operational technology environment spans generation sites, storage systems, and the monitoring infrastructure that ties them together. The threat model for an independent power producer of this scale includes SCADA compromise, supply chain integrity across project construction, and the integrity of real-time telemetry from distributed assets.
